群組相關的 Amazon ECS任務 - Amazon Elastic Container Service

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

群組相關的 Amazon ECS任務

您可以識別一組相關任務,並將其放置在任務群組中。在使用 spread 任務置放策略時,會將所有具有相同任務群組名稱的任務視為一組。例如,假設您在一個叢集執行不同的應用程式,例如資料庫和 Web 伺服器。為了確保您在各個可用區域中之資料庫的平衡,請將它們新增至名為 databases 的任務群組,然後使用 spread 任務置放策略。如需詳細資訊,請參閱使用策略來定義 Amazon ECS任務置放

任務群組也可用作任務放置限制條件。當您在 memberOf 限制條件中指定任務群組時,任務只會傳送到在指定任務群組中執行的容器執行個體。如需範例,請參閱Amazon ECS任務置放限制範例

根據預設,若未指定自訂任務群組名稱,獨立任務會使用任務定義系列名稱 (如 family:my-task-definition) 做為任務群組名稱。若任務做為服務的一部分啟動,它將使用服務名稱做為任務群組名稱,而且該名稱無法被變更。

任務群組適用下列需求。

  • 任務群組名稱必須在 255 個字元以下。

  • 每個任務只能在一個群組中。

  • 啟動任務之後,就無法修改其任務群組。